How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 72701?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 72701 Studio Apartments | $1,274 | $725 | $1,556 |
| 72701 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,366 | $495 | $5,384 |
| 72701 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,510 | $495 | $5,345 |
| 72701 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,217 | $699 | $8,273 |
| 72701 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,805 | $459 | $11,229 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 72701 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 72701?
There are currently 43 Studio Apartments in 72701 with rent ranges from $725 to $1,556 with an average price of $1,274.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 72701 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 72701 ranges from $495 to $5,384 with an average monthly rent of $1,366.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 72701 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 72701 range from $495 to $5,345.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,510.
How expensive are 72701 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 112 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 72701 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$699 to $8,273 - averaging $2,217 for the location.
